Our Values

The five spiritual values of the Xaverian Brothers—humility, compassion, simplicity, trust and zeal—inspire our community daily and call us to lives of faith and service. Though the values are closely connected to the Brothers' founding and history, they are very much a part of the day-to-day life of students at St. John's. Each year, our school community chooses one or two values to focus on and incorporate in daily prayers, academic lessons, service projects, and in co-curricular activities. Each of the values carries its own significance in the context of a Xaverian education, and students find meaning in them well beyond their time at St. John's.

Cultural Priorities

St. John's Prep has developed three cultural priorities that stem from our mission and from the Fundamental Principles of the Xaverian Brothers. We use this series of cultural priorities to guide the way we do our work and operate as an institution. Our goal is to make these priorities a lived reality in the lives of our students, parents, faculty, staff, coaches, and the greater St. John's Prep community.

  1. We see all people as created in the image and likeness of God.
  2. We seek to embrace a habit of excellence in all endeavors.
  3. We seek to empower all whom we encounter to be unique expressions of God's love in our world.
